> On Mar 24, 2015, at 11:28 AM, Paul Stenquist <[email protected]> wrote: > > Ralph and I discussed this technique briefly in the recent equipment thread. > There were a number of digitizers available in the mid ‘80s that could create > a digital photo from a single video frame using a video camera attached to a > black box device and a computer. I think the device I had was called Seeing > Eye, but I can find no reference on the web. The computer was a 128K Apple > Iic, and the video camera was a big Sharp VHS unit. I remember the girls, > Heidi and Ingrid, had to sit still for about 15 seconds, not easy for them > back then. The year must have been about 1986, judging by their apparent ages > here.
